ESP32 Zigbee CCT Light

ESP32 Zigbee CCT Light is an open-source firmware for ESP32-C6 and ESP32-H2 microcontrollers, turning them into a Zigbee tunable white (CCT) LED controller.
It integrates seamlessly with Home Assistant (ZHA) and other Zigbee Home Automation coordinators.

Features

  • Brightness control – smooth dimming up and down.
  • Color temperature control – via Zigbee Color Control cluster (mireds, warm <-> cool white).
  • Startup behavior – choose whether the lamp should power up:
    • always ON,
    • always OFF,
    • or restore the last state.
  • Customizable transition times – configure how fast the lamp fades when switching or changing parameters.
  • Local button support:
    • single press – toggle ON/OFF,
    • double press – cycle through presets (different brightness/temperature combinations),
    • long press – factory reset.
  • Zigbee groups support – control the light as part of a group, even without the coordinator.

Zigbee Clusters

This device implements the following Zigbee Home Automation clusters (server role):

Cluster Functionality
Basic ZCL version, power source, manufacturer name (4DERT), model (Lamp), date code
Identify Identify mode support (used for pairing/diagnostics)
Groups Group addressing (ON/OFF, Level, Color Control)
On/Off Main power control, with StartUpOnOff attribute (restore last state / ON / OFF)
Level Control Brightness control (CurrentLevel), on/off transition times
Color Control Color temperature control (mireds only); physical min/max limits

Hardware

  • ESP32-C6 / ESP32-H2 devkit or module (with Zigbee support).
  • Two logic-level N-MOSFETs (e.g. IRLZ44N) controlling warm-white and cool-white LED channels.
  • Step-down regulator (VIN → 5V) to power the ESP32.
  • Optional push-button connected to a GPIO (for local control and factory reset) – you can also use the built-in BOOT button on the devkit.
  • Optional status LED with resistor connected to a GPIO – or use the built-in LED available on most devkits.
  • LED strips powered directly from VIN (e.g. 12V or 24V).

Integration

  • Tested with Home Assistant (ZHA).
  • Should also work with Zigbee2MQTT and other HA-profile compatible coordinators.

Building & Flashing

  1. Clone the repository and open it in VS Code.
    A ready-to-use Dev Container is provided – once you open the project in VS Code with the Dev Containers extension, it will automatically pull an environment with ESP-IDF, Python tools, and dependencies preinstalled.

  2. If building locally, install ESP-IDF.

  3. Select target:

    idf.py set-target esp32c6/esp32h2
  4. Build, flash and monitor:

    idf.py build flash monitor
